What is the definition of a Mode S transponder?

Explanation:
The definition of a Mode S transponder is indeed related to its role as an airborne ATC transponder, specifically detailed in the Canadian Technical Standard Order (CAN-TSO-C112). Mode S transponders are designed to provide aircraft identification and altitude information to air traffic control. They operate using selective addressing, which allows for communication with ground-based radar systems without interference from other aircraft, thereby enhancing airspace safety and efficiency. The importance of the Mode S transponder lies in its ability to transmit data not just to radar, but also to cooperate with Automatic Dependent Surveillance-Broadcast (ADS-B) systems. This means that it can provide both passive and active surveillance capabilities, helping improve situational awareness for air traffic management. Understanding this technology is vital for aviation professionals because it forms a crucial part of modern air traffic control and operations, increasing safety by ensuring accurate tracking and communication of aircraft during flight.
